Mewis return adds to Manchester City’s impressive squad
Given Manchester City’s recent form, the return of Sam Mewis from injury was not exactly a necessity, but return she did – and in style. Making an immediate impact, Mewis scored two goals as City broke down a stubborn Birmingham City side.
The transformation of potentially weak links in the squad into excellent starters has been part of what has been so impressive about Gareth Taylor’s side. Mewis’ injury was initially thought to be a big loss but it has barely been noticed. Meanwhile, Laura Coombs looked impressive in midfield, offering yet another option in an increasingly competitive area.
